The first software of cross-joined polyethylene is in the development of pipework units and radiant heating and cooling units. It is also used for domestic h2o piping and as insulation for top voltage electrical cables.

This composition is often represented because of the system CH2=CH2. This double bond can be damaged by positioning the molecule under the impact of polymerization catalysts. The ensuing added single bond may be utilized to hyperlink A further carbon atom for the ethylene molecule. So, the ethylene molecule can be built into a big, polymeric molecule.
Plumbing and irrigation techniques often use polyethylene pipes as a consequence of its adaptability, resistance to corrosion, and affordability in comparison to steel pipes. They are also used in sewage and gasoline distribution methods.

HDPE is Employed in items and packaging which include milk jugs, detergent bottles, margarine tubs, garbage containers and h2o pipes. HDPE is usually extensively Utilized in the creation of fireworks. Polyethylene might be classified into numerous differing kinds based on the density in the plastic as well as diploma of branching in its structure. The kind of branching plus the extent of branching has a direct impact on the mechanical Homes with the plastic.
Drinking water resistance: Mainly because polyethylene is hydrophobic, it's a significant diploma of resistance to drinking water absorption. For this reason characteristic, it’s perfect for utilizes exactly where water resistance is necessary, like h2o pipes, marine properties, and out of doors household furniture.
A tablet box presented into a technician at ICI in 1936 made from the primary pound of polyethylene The first industrially functional polyethylene synthesis (diazomethane is a notoriously unstable material that is mostly avoided in industrial syntheses) was once again unintentionally discovered in 1933 by Eric Fawcett and Reginald Gibson on the Imperial Chemical Industries (ICI) is effective in Northwich, England.[15] Upon applying particularly high stress (many hundred atmospheres) to a combination of ethylene and benzaldehyde they again created a white, waxy content. Since the response were initiated by trace oxygen contamination inside their equipment, the experiment was tricky to reproduce at first.
